Restaurant on Had Lamai 4, which is thought of as an unnamed street, a little north of the gas station and morning market (same side of the street). Has a daily changing menu which usually includes Thai dishes with mock meat options. Removed honey in 2016. Open Mon-Fri 12:00pm-3:30pm.

Lamai Veggie typically serves daily set meals plus optional extras (e.g. mock meats, kombucha for 50 baht, and desserts). The set meals themselves are quite inexpensive, but the extras can add up quickly.
Read moreAlmost everything Bee serves is plant-based, but vegans should take note that Bee sometimes offers non-vegan desserts (made by someone outside, not Bee herself) that include honey. These desserts typically have little cards on which the ingredients are listed, so it's easy to know which ones are vegan by reading the ingredients.
